Background:
SLBP binds to the stem-loop structure in replication-dependent histone mRNAs. Histone mRNAs do not contain introns or polyadenylation signals, and are processed by endonucleolytic cleavage. The stem-loop structure is essential for efficient processing but this structure also controls the transport, translation and stability of histone mRNAs. Expression of SLBP is regulated during the cell cycle, increasing more than 10-fold during the latter part of G1.

Target/Specificity:
The synthetic peptide sequence used to generate the antibody AP1931a was selected from the C-term region of human SLBP. A 10 to 100 fold molar excess to antibody is recommended. Precise conditions should be optimized for a particular assay.
